Abstract
An active link wireless cable mesh network and a method for transmitting data in a wireless cable mesh network are provided. A plurality of end devices are connected in a mesh configuration. A data message is transmitted to a first end device via one of a plurality of antennas radiating elements which form a phased array antenna. If the message is not successfully received, the antenna radiating elements is steered to another transceiver in the mesh network to complete the transmission.

3. A method of transmitting data in a wireless cable mesh network, the method comprising:
-
transmitting, from a phased array antenna, a signal to a first transceiver in the wireless cable mesh network, the signal transmitted over a first communication link associated with a first one of a plurality of antennas which form the phased array antenna, wherein a plurality of transceivers in the wireless cable mesh network are configured to provide access to a cable network; determining whether the first communication link between the first one of the plurality of antennas of the phased array antenna and the first transceiver is unavailable; and steering the first one of the plurality of antennas to a second transceiver in the wireless cable mesh network when the first communication link between the first one of the plurality of antennas of the phased array antenna and the transceiver is unavailable, the second transceiver being communicatively coupled to the first transceiver in a wireless mesh network. - View Dependent Claims (4, 5, 6)
